Resumo
Carbides in annealed steel H13 without magnesium and with a micro-addition of magnesium (0.0010%) are studied. Trace amounts of magnesium strengthen carbide segregation and reduce their size. Carbides phases M7C3, M6 C, and M(C, N) are detected in steel H13, and this agrees with results of thermodynamic calculations.
